ML0542Conserved hypothetical protein; Promotes RNA polymerase assembly. Latches the N- and C- terminal regions of the beta' subunit thereby facilitating its interaction with the beta and alpha subunits (By similarity). (110 aa)
dgtSimilar to Mycobacterium tuberculosis deoxyguanosinetriphosphate triphosphohydrolase dgt or Rv2344c or MTCY98.13c SW:DGTP_MYCTU (P95240) (431 aa) fasta scores: E(): 0, 83.8% id in 421 aa and to many hypothetical deoxyguanosine hydrolases. Contains Pfam match to entry PF01966 HD, HD domain; Belongs to the dGTPase family. Type 2 subfamily. (429 aa)
dnaGDNA primase; RNA polymerase that catalyzes the synthesis of short RNA molecules used as primers for DNA polymerase during DNA replication. (642 aa)

dnaEDNA polymerase III, [alpha] subunit; DNA polymerase III is a complex, multichain enzyme responsible for most of the replicative synthesis in bacteria. This DNA polymerase also exhibits 3' to 5' exonuclease activity. The alpha chain is the DNA polymerase (By similarity); Belongs to the DNA polymerase type-C family. DnaE subfamily. (1177 aa)

ML1512Conserved hypothetical protein; An RNase that has 5'-3' exonuclease and possibly endonuclease activity. Involved in maturation of rRNA and in some organisms also mRNA maturation and/or decay. (558 aa)
rpoC[beta]' subunit of RNA polymerase; DNA-dependent RNA polymerase catalyzes the transcription of DNA into RNA using the four ribonucleoside triphosphates as substrates. (1316 aa)
rpoB[beta] subunit of RNA polymerase; DNA-dependent RNA polymerase catalyzes the transcription of DNA into RNA using the four ribonucleoside triphosphates as substrates. (1178 aa)
